I've never needed a schematic for a cap can. All the ones have ever replaced state on the can the uF and next to it a symbol (triangle, square, circle, D) and the leads on the bottom are marked with the same symbols. Take pictures of the wiring connections before unsoldering. I also hand draw how all the different wires connect to each cap/symbol.

The problem is, the original schematic doesn't have any cap values on it, so you're left to wonder what the values actually are supposed to be. And, there doesn't seem to be a schematic with the values floating around the web. The original can cap is supposed to be 30,20,20,10, which seems like the reverse order to the schem. to me. Looks like you would hook it up as 10,20,20,30, so that C1 (10uf) would be for the 12x4 rectifier, etc.

jeff
 
Don't think the order of the cap values in the can (or printed on the can) has anything to do with how they are connected to the rest of the circuit. Have replaced many multi-cap cans and have never assumed the order of the uF values meant anything.
 
It does seem strange that the Dynaco PAS manual schematic doesn't list the uF values for the can. (And I checked a ST-70 manual and same for that one.)
I believe the original PAS was 30-20-20-10 @450v.
And whatever can you think is a good replacement, watch out for the height (around 2") if you want the PAS cover to still fit.
